动态数据列表视图

时间:2016-03-10 15:30:57

标签: windows-phone-8.1 winrt-xaml

我有一个应该填充listview的模型。根据类型,我需要显示可能的答案列表。

{
    "Question" (string): ("Please choose the one of the followings best suitable to your situation.")
    Type (enum) (Type.Radio, Type.FreeText, Type.Number, Type.Checkbox)
    List<Answers> ({"It was cold inside.", 
        "It was cold but the heaters turned on after asking." 
        "It was warm" })
    RequiresComments (bool) (true)
}

问题数量将来自服务器。它可能是70个问题,其中一些是无线电,其中一些是复选框,其中一些只是自由文本。

我在Android和iOS上做过这个,但我不知道怎么做是在Windows Phone 8.1上。任何人都可以给我一个例子或指出我正确的方向吗?

1 个答案:

答案 0 :(得分:0)

在您的视图中有一个带枚举的单选按钮。用户选择类型后,从服务器获取答案。

获取答案列表后。将列表视图(在您的视图中)Itemssource设置为您获得的答案列表。

评论部分,您可以使用bool并使用转换器更改评论文本框(在视图中)的可见性。